Do you believe in fairy tales and wishing wells? What if Snow White falls in love with Cinderella? And what if the coin being tossed in that deep wishing well has exactly the same two faces? Just. What. If. Jane Marie Salazar is a graduating student from an exclusive all-girls school. She is rich and the only daughter of an advertising executive and a successful business woman. Jane is smart, tough, out-going and risk-taker. She likes to gamble in life, no "ifs" and no "buts." "Auntie," a woman in her 40s, still awed by the beauty of Taal Volcano, spends most of her time just staring on it. She lives with her soon-to-wed niece named Yasmin, in a house that has a perfect view of the popular scenic spot in Tagaytay City. Broken and tormented by her past love, she literally shuts her door and opted not to marry. Marsha Julia Santos, on the other hand, is the exact opposite of Jane. She is a bank teller in one of the prestigious banks in our country. Marsha is prim and proper, raised in a strict Catholic household. A conformist and do whatever it takes to please others, especially for her family and boyfriend. Her long-time boyfriend, Rex is an abusive, possessive, and controlling boyfriend. The "Owner" of Tapsilog Haus, married to a successful real estate agent. She is a caring and loving mother to her only daughter, Nadine. Her life is almost complete - a loving family, a stable business. But there is a piece of her still missing...a closure from her one true love. Four women crossed paths, changed and fell helplessly in love in a world where relationship like theirs at that time were considered unacceptable and taboo. But will their love endure the pain, conflict, and surpass the test of time? And how will these four women reconnect and help each other find answers to one thing common and puzzling them...LOVE.

Nadia de Marco knew what she wanted in life and that is to be the most powerful woman in the country. Growing up in the Philippines, she knew that it would be an uphill climb. There is misogyny everywhere, but instead of fighting it, she decided to use it to her advantage. That is probably the upside of being undermined, being almost invisible-people will never see you coming. While she was watching everyone's moves, no one was watching hers. Things were going according to plan until Avery Brienne Eliseo came into the picture. Suddenly, she got an enemy. And unlike Avery who has her cousin by her side, she has no one. And she needs to have someone. She's been looking for so long until she found Archibald Reign Gallego-the perfect partner in crime... or so she thought.

The tragedy of the poor is not that they seek to die, but that even in death, the city finds a way to put them to work. Elias came to Recto to kill himself. A scholar stripped of his books and his home, he has one goal: a cheap motel room and a final act of acceptance. But Manila is a predator that refuses to let a body go to waste. When Seb-a sex worker-mistakes Elias's room for a job, the scholar's exit strategy is violently derailed. Trapped between a man trying to leave the world and a man trying to afford to stay in, Elias is forced to confront a devastating truth.
